RENO, Nev. — Israeli unmanned aircraft manufacturer Steadicopter has completed a U.S. airworthiness validation for its Black Eagle 50E electric unmanned helicopter, supporting expanded flight operations, testing and customer evaluations in the United States.
U.S. Airworthiness Validation
The Nevada Unmanned Aircraft Systems Test Site (UASTS), operated by the University of Nevada, Reno, conducted the validation on two Black Eagle 50E aircraft. Following the process, Nevada UASTS issued an Airworthiness Statement covering Black Eagle 50E aircraft operated in the United States by Alchemy Analytics, which operates as flyAlchemy.
The validation works alongside existing Federal Aviation Administration (FAA) Certificates of Waiver or Authorization (COAs). Together, the approvals cover designated operating areas totaling more than 8,100 square miles (21,000 square kilometers).
The approvals provide a basis for ongoing flight testing, training, customer demonstrations and mission evaluations, moving the aircraft beyond limited one-time demonstration flights.
Moving Toward Mission Evaluations
Steadicopter CEO Noam Lidor said the validation provides the foundation for sustained U.S. operations and for evaluating the Black Eagle 50E against actual customer and mission requirements.
Conrad Wright, founder of flyAlchemy, said the next phase will focus on payload selection, payload integration and operational evaluations.
flyAlchemy operates the U.S. program from Reno-Stead Airport in Nevada. It supports flight operations, airworthiness and regulatory work, aircraft staging, mission development and preparation for customer demonstrations and evaluations.
Steadicopter and flyAlchemy formalized their U.S. partnership in March 2026. Under the agreement, Steadicopter provides Black Eagle 50E systems for demonstration flights, customer evaluations, payload integration and mission development for U.S. government and commercial users.
Black Eagle 50E Capabilities
Introduced in 2022, the Black Eagle 50E is an all-electric vertical takeoff and landing (VTOL) unmanned helicopter.
| Specification | Black Eagle 50E |
|---|---|
| Maximum takeoff weight | 50 kg (110 lb) |
| Combined payload and battery capacity | Up to 30 kg (66 lb) |
| Endurance | Approximately 2 hours |
| Takeoff and landing | Vertical (VTOL) |
The electric propulsion system replaces the gasoline engines used on earlier Black Eagle models and reduces overall weight, allowing capacity for sensors or batteries. Its VTOL design means the aircraft does not require a conventional runway and can operate from confined or remote locations, including ships.
The aircraft uses a modular open architecture supporting payloads such as electro-optical/infrared (EO/IR) sensors, maritime patrol radar, synthetic aperture radar (SAR), automatic identification system (AIS) receivers and signals intelligence (SIGINT) systems.
The Israeli Navy ordered the Black Eagle 50E in 2022 for coastal security and maritime surveillance.
Planned U.S. Applications
In the United States, Steadicopter and flyAlchemy are developing potential missions covering:
- Defense and homeland security
- Intelligence, surveillance and reconnaissance (ISR)
- Public safety
- Emergency response
- Critical infrastructure monitoring
- Remote sensing
With the airworthiness validation completed, the companies plan to conduct mission-specific demonstrations, integrate additional payloads, engage U.S. customers and pursue additional operating areas as requirements develop.
